Accidents Occur Upwards of Five Times a Day

The California Highway Patrol's Statewide Integrated Traffic Records System (SWITRS) reported that in 2006, 29 people died and 1,891 were injured in Riverside car crashes--that's almost five per day. Four pedestrians were killed and 88 were injured in car collisions. One bicyclist was killed and 71 were injured in crashes. Five motorcyclists were killed and 91 were injured. Drunk drivers caused 18 fatalities and 201 injuries. In 2007, 29 car collisions ended in 31 deaths.

Keep Records on Injuries, Losses and Expenses

An experienced Riverside auto accident lawyer knows how often car collisions occur and how complicated they can get. Which is why they advise car accident victims to keep detailed records regarding their injuries, losses and expenses. This can be very hard to do, since car crash victims are emotionally drained, if not physically impaired. Besides, there are doctor visits, police reports, car repairs and school/job rescheduling requirements to deal with. This is where friends and relatives can sometimes help. What you need to keep in mind is that these records will be invaluable in helping you negotiate a just settlement with insurance companies.

For all car accident settlements, patients (or their attorneys) are required to gather evidence, present it to the insurance company, and negotiate a resolution. Remember that when you record your expenses and damages, never omit any items, for this will lower the value of your claim. Conversely, never exaggerate your losses, for you'll undermine your credibility, and possibly raise doubts as to your claim's legitimacy.

Don't Wait Until It's Too Late: California Statutes of Limitations

Governmental Claim - 6 months | Personal Injury - 2 years | Minor's Personal Injury - 2 years after minor's 18th birthday | Professional Negligence: 1 Year
